Transaction 64ebe647405b84bf6a6b757fe4020c106793bc68a5f4d1e92cbde370985582fc
1 Input
1 Output
-
64ebe647405b84bf6a6b757fe4020c106793bc68a5f4d1e92cbde370985582fc:0
- value
- 989808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b33a0e87d5142190b7bfa457e7f77faed4e65e06 OP_EQUAL
- address
- 3J2gRjdXJYw2et1cMpVZfktKfvShbRKTAf